Output 8a511ecfc5d3568e652f2b51bf10069b8152a2608384fb26e6239ae77d875624:95

value
474993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c26de8aa18c49ae2b2120f70bb4eb58bba21a7c OP_EQUAL
address
37B52jsuSo8kHJ9uV5vL99oj4kXX3C4cvz
transaction
8a511ecfc5d3568e652f2b51bf10069b8152a2608384fb26e6239ae77d875624
confirmations
156916
spent
true